Output 99966865ed0dca7037b7331a73ccde3f37d6cf140c2f5463c88071e333ae45f5:0

value
4166175
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1343699148eeb62dcdbf709679877dd1aab70301 OP_EQUAL
address
33SsX5jDKCCDyLL7BTnAC7xPhFZYzoUaqK
transaction
99966865ed0dca7037b7331a73ccde3f37d6cf140c2f5463c88071e333ae45f5
confirmations
219012
spent
true